bennyman123abc avatar bennyman123abc commented on June 12, 2024 1

The reason that Discord is used currently is because Discord is pretty much relied on for rendering parts of the tag; at least out of the box. However, Larsen does have a point with the new version of RiiTag coming out. It's been in the works for a while now, and while it has hit a small stall in development, we're working on getting it up and running again soon to hopefully deploy. I'll look into adding more SSO options, but we're also not going to be handling authentication on our end as that would be far to insecure and really just unneeded.

TL;DR: More SSO options will not be added to RiiTag as of now, but the next version of RiiTag will have more than Discord on release.
